Beaulieu is a commune in the Haute-Loire department of France, situated within the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region. It lies in the arrondissement of Le Puy-en-Velay and the canton of Vorey, with an associated electoral district of Emblavez-et-Meygal. The postal code for the area is 43800.
The commune covers an area of 22.27 square kilometers and has a population of 1,096, comprising 499 males and 530 females. It is located near the Loire river and shares borders with Chamalières-sur-Loire, Lavoûte-sur-Loire, Malrevers, and Rosières. Understand
Beaulieu means "beautiful place" in French, and from 1204 was home to a Cistercian abbey. The village has been owned by the Montagu family since the dissolution of Beaulieu Abbey, and they have followed a policy of developing the tourist potential of the village, resulting in a mixture of attractions from the National Motor Museum, Palace House and Beaulieu Abbey. The village itself is very attractive, clustering around the mill pond and the tidal headwaters of the Beaulieu River. Keep an eye open for the ponies and donkeys which can often be found congregating in the village's main street.
